20110174598Tote for conveyor - A tote for a conveyor system may include an upper part and a lower part. The upper part may define an upper, article-supporting surface. The article-supporting surface may be adapted to receive and support articles while the articles are conveyed in or on the tote. The lower part may define a lower, substantially plane bearing surface that extends over an area substantially equal to the article-supporting surface. The upper and lower parts may be transparent to X-rays. The upper and lower parts may be made from fire-retardant material. A plurality of support points and areas may be provided between the upper part and the lower part in order to transfer forces between the article-supporting surface and the bearing surface.07-21-2011
20100176663SORTING SYSTEM WITH LINEAR SYNCHRONOUS MOTOR DRIVE - The present invention relates to a sorting system including a conveyor comprising a plurality of carts for carrying articles, in particular for sorting articles such as parcels and baggage. The conveyor has a linear synchronous motor drive system with stators arranged along a track which the carts follow. Reaction elements are mounted on each of the carts. The reaction elements each comprise an even or an uneven number of permanent magnets arranged on a plate-like carrier. The magnets on reaction elements of adjacent carts are arranged to form arrow of magnets with alternating polarity, said row having two neighbouring magnets. At least one of the two neighbouring magnets has a reduced dimension in the transport direction, and the two neighbouring magnets are situated at a transition between adjacent carts.07-15-2010
20100175967SORTING SYSTEM WITH LINEAR SYNCHRONOUS MOTOR DRIVE - The present invention relates to a sorting system including a conveyor comprising a plurality of carts for carrying articles, in particular for sorting articles such as parcels and baggage. The conveyor has a linear synchronous motor drive system with stators arranged along a track which the carts follow. It is an object of the present invention to provide an improved sorting system as well as to provide a sorting system with improved energy utilisation and efficiency. Reaction elements are mounted on each of the carts. The reaction elements each comprise an uneven number of permanent magnets arranged on a plate-like carrier. The magnets on reaction elements of adjacent carts are arranged to form arrow of magnets with constant pitch and alternating polarity said row having an interruption situated at a transition between adjacent carts. A maximum number of coils in the stator may thereby be active at the same time, when driving the conveyor.07-15-2010
